How they compare
Small states currently reports 462,129 number against 157,961 number in Argentina, a difference of 304,168 number.
That makes Small states's figure about 2.9 times Argentina's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 22 shared years of data; in 1974 it was Argentina ahead.
Argentina ranks 37th and Small states ranks 40th of 138 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Argentina averaged higher in 1 and Small states in 3.

About this data
Number of adolescents and youth of secondary school age who are not enrolled or attending school during in a given academic year. For more information, consult the UNESCO Institute of Statistics website: http://www.uis.unesco.org/Education/
